Herb Forward Terpenes

Herb-forward terpene profiles emphasize aromatic compounds commonly associated with culinary and medicinal herbs—such as myrcene, pinene, and limonene—rather than fruity or floral notes. These profiles often emerge from landrace genetics and cultivars bred for traditional aromatic properties. Lineage records frequently report herb-forward characteristics in plants descended from Central Asian, Mediterranean, and Southeast Asian cannabis populations. The category encompasses diverse volatile compound combinations that breeders describe as "herbal," "spicy," "earthy," or "piney." This terpene family has remained relatively stable across generations in many heirloom and preservation-focused breeding programs.

Breeder relevance

Breeders working to preserve traditional genetics or develop cultivars for aromatic stability often select for herb-forward terpene expression. Maintaining these profiles typically requires careful phenotype selection and environmental controls, as herbaceous volatiles can shift under stress or suboptimal growing conditions.
